    Redwinds, being hit capped is no longer the must have that it once was. With most of our damage coming from now coming from our damage over time spells, mind flay being changed to a channeled DoT, and Mind Blast currently doing seriously weak damage hit is nowhere near as important. Hit rating required to push consistent and high damage per second is now based on how quickly you are able to react to a missed spell.

    With my current hit rating, over a 6 minute period on a boss test dummy, I was able to push around 11k DPS self-buffed. When I converted the correct stats to Spirit instead (reaching the hit cap), I noticed a 2k DPS loss in the same 6 minute test period.

    I feel that with the current Shadow Priest mechanics, if you are a focused raider, you should be able to do more DPS while sacrificing Hit instead of the previous sacrificing other stats to be hit capped.

    I think that using potential mana loss as an argument for being hit capped is a good idea, but with the massive amount of mana regenerating cooldowns that Shadow Priests posess, I am never finding myself hurting for mana.
